Serbian bean stew simmers white beans with onion, carrot, paprika, and beef sausage until thick and warming.

Soak the beans in water overnight.
Drain the beans and cook them in fresh water for 45 minutes.
Soften the onions, carrots, and garlic in oil for 7 minutes.
Add the sliced beef sausage and turn for 4 minutes.
Add the tomato paste, paprika, bay leaves, salt, and black pepper.
Transfer the beans to the pot with their cooking water.
Cook over low heat for 40 to 45 minutes, until thickened.
💡 Tip: Mash one ladle of the beans and stir it back into the pot to thicken pasulj naturally without flour.
🍽️ Serving suggestion: Serve pasulj hot with bread, pickles, and chopped parsley.
